
Canada's At Risk Populations: An Introduction to Case Management
by John Charles
O tej książce
Canada’s At Risk Populations: An Introduction to Case Management offers a thorough instructional guide to those interested in the role of case manager. Chapters provide an introduction to this valuable occupation, assessing and working with risk, the various types of reports and documentation, and local service exploration. There is also an introduction to the unique needs of the various populations that Canadian case managers work with, including indigenous people, seniors, the LGBTQ+ community, persons with physical or psychological disabilities, children and youth, those with HIV/AIDS or Hepatitis, the autistic community, and victims of domestic violence, homelessness, or human trafficking. Chapter exercises provide learning scenarios for each population, their particular challenges, and the specific factors case managers must consider in order to get them the help they need.
